Like a Dragon Pirate Yakuza Gameplay Unveiled at Live Stream

by Claire Feb 02,2025

Get ready to set sail! RGG Studio's Like a Dragon Direct, airing January 9th, 2025, will unveil extensive gameplay footage for the highly anticipated Like a Dragon: Pirate Yakuza in Hawaii.

Like a Dragon Pirate Yakuza Gameplay Reveal

This February release stars the iconic Goro Majima, embarking on a swashbuckling adventure after the events of Like a Dragon: Infinite Wealth. Shipwrecked and amnesiac, Majima's journey to recover his memories promises thrilling action and unexpected treasure.

The Like a Dragon Direct, streaming on SEGA's official YouTube and Twitch channels, will offer a deep dive into the game's pirate-themed world. While the focus is on Like a Dragon: Pirate Yakuza in Hawaii, fans eagerly await potential news on other RGG Studio projects, including the mysterious Project Century and the rumored Yakuza 3 Kiwami remake.

Like a Dragon Pirate Yakuza Gameplay Reveal

Prepare for a barrage of gameplay reveals and exciting details. Like a Dragon: Pirate Yakuza in Hawaii launches February 21st, 2025, on PC, P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, Xbox Series X|S, and Xbox One.
